摘要

Turbine blades in aircraft engines operate under extreme high temperatures, with inlet temperatures reaching up to 2200 K. To reduce the blade temperature and extend service life, film cooling holes are typically designed. However, traditional micro-drilling techniques struggle to meet the high precision demands of modern aircraft engines. Femtosecond laser has emerged as an ideal method for processing film cooling holes due to its ultra-high precision and minimal heat-affected zone. However, the stringent requirements for processing film cooling holes on nickel-based alloys using femtosecond lasers result in a narrow selection range of laser parameters. Furthermore, researching the cooling characteristics of film cooling holes processed by lasers is also crucial in practical applications. In this study, the effects of laser parameters on the taper angle and surface morphology of micro-holes in nickel-based superalloys are investigated. Based on the actual morphology of micro-holes (serves as a film cooling hole) prepared by femtosecond laser, the effects of hole inclination and taper angle on their cooling characteristics are further investigated. The results show that both the surface morphology and taper angle can be effectively controlled by optimizing the process parameters. In micro-holes with well-defined inlet and outlet morphologies, the taper angle ranges from 4° to 8°. The cooling efficiency of air film holes with taper angles from 4° to 8° is similar, with cooling efficiency at the hole exit reaching up to 98 % and covering the parameters of our actual fabricating. This finding suggests that the process window of femtosecond laser fabricating of air film cooling holes is broadened, offering greater flexibility in selecting laser processing parameters.
